Definitions

chuāi (verb) to put into (one's pockets, clothes)
chuǎi (verb) to estimate; to guess; to figure

About

The character "揣" is composed of the hand radical 扌 and the component 耑, which originally functioned as a phonetic element. Its earliest meanings centered on physical actions performed by the hand, specifically measuring or gauging dimensions, which naturally extended to abstract senses of estimation and speculation. Later usage developed the meaning of carrying or hiding items within one's clothing, as seen in the verb sense of tucking something away. While the phonetic connection to 耑 has weakened in modern pronunciation, the hand radical continues to signal the character's relation to manual or physical actions across its range of meanings.
